When I hear "baguette bag," I think of Fendi’s rectangular purse that Carrie Bradshaw toted around New York City while chasing after Mr. Big. When Rihanna hears "baguette bag," she thinks of a literal loaf of bread slung across her body. While heading to dine at NYC’s number one scene-y Italian spot, Carbone, the Fenty mogul was seen wearing a plush crossbody bag shaped like an actual baguette. What brand makes the bread bag? Unclear.

Ease triumphs over effort in this summer's bag trends. That’s not to say the mood of the summer 2025 collections was minimal; statement bags were abundant—think free-spirited, fringed boho bags and sequined party purses that Bianca Jagger would’ve swung around Studio 54. This summer’s bags are effortless because they’re outfit finishers you can grab in the half-second before leaving the house.
